- W3048162711 abstract "Abstract The generalized aggregation arises in many research fields including applied probability, actuarial science, and reliability theory, where is a bivariate kernel function and a is a parameter vector. One of its remarkable features is that both X and W are dependent in many practical situations. Therefore, studying the stochastic properties of generalized aggregations under various dependence structures is an interesting and meaningful problem. In this paper, by using left tail weakly stochastic arrangement increasing, right tail weakly stochastic arrangement increasing, and comonotonicity to characterize the dependent structures among X or W , we establish the increasing convex ordering and the expectation ordering of generalized aggregations to investigate the effects of the arrangement and heterogeneity among a i 's. Numerical examples and three practical applications are presented to illustrate our results as well." @default.
